In the expansive and frigid landscape of Antarctica, immense glaciers exhibit a perpetual state of motion. These colossal bodies of ice navigate through the icy terrain along designated pathways, aptly termed ice streams. These ice streams serve as dynamic conduits of swifter ice flow within the vast glacier systems, transporting substantial quantities of ice and sediment debris towards the encompassing oceanic expanse.
